如何通过Hadoop修改目录名称
在使用Hadoop进行数据处理时,有时候我们需要修改Hadoop中的目录名称。这篇文章将介绍如何通过Hadoop命令行工具进行目录名称修改。
实际问题
假设我们有一个名为/user/input
的目录,我们需要将其修改为/user/data
。我们将使用Hadoop的命令行工具来完成这个操作。
示例
步骤一:进入Hadoop命令行界面
首先,我们需要进入Hadoop的命令行界面。可以通过执行以下命令来进入:
hadoop fs
步骤二:修改目录名称
在Hadoop的命令行界面中,使用mv
命令来修改目录名称。执行以下命令:
hadoop fs -mv /user/input /user/data
这将把/user/input
目录重命名为/user/data
。
步骤三:验证修改
最后,可以使用ls
命令来验证目录名称是否已经修改成功。执行以下命令:
hadoop fs -ls /user
你将看到/user
目录下已经有了data
目录,而input
目录已经不存在了。
总结
通过以上步骤,我们成功地使用Hadoop命令行工具修改了目录名称。在实际工作中,我们可以根据需要修改Hadoop中的目录名称,以便更好地组织和管理数据。
类图
classDiagram
class Hadoop {
- String inputDirectory
- String outputDirectory
+ void modifyDirectoryName(String oldName, String newName)
}
在本文中,我们使用Hadoop
类的modifyDirectoryName
方法来修改目录名称。
通过以上步骤,你已经学会了如何通过Hadoop命令行工具修改目录名称。希望这篇文章对你有所帮助!